Fileja are traditional Calabrian hand-rolled pasta, often served with rich goat or pork ragù. They are a hallmark of local home cooking and festive meals.
Lagane e ceci is an old southern dish of rustic pasta strips with chickpeas, valued for its peasant roots and comforting flavor across Calabria.
Surici fritti are lightly floured fried anchovies, popular on the Tyrrhenian coast near Paola. They are prized for freshness and simple seaside flavor.

Moderate for southern Italy. Hotels and trains are reasonable, while tourist-area dining costs more in peak season. Overall cheaper than Rome, Milan, or Amalfi.
Service is often included or modest. Round up or leave 5-10% at restaurants for good service. Taxis are usually rounded up. Small change is enough in cafes.
